Output 88b99ba4d9d1ea051ee8a4d57177bd6ddcbc2b74b249c1beb375c010c1942e83:0

value
996032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c4278134d8b1c758143c6f85dd384205eff61a OP_EQUAL
address
3FLubAesEmVSbfcum11FPQQCSokNLBUUTi
transaction
88b99ba4d9d1ea051ee8a4d57177bd6ddcbc2b74b249c1beb375c010c1942e83
confirmations
309051
spent
true